package com.fengdu.gas.repository.mapper;
|
|
import com.fengdu.gas.repository.BasicMapper;
|
import com.fengdu.gas.repository.po.DataUploadRecordDayPO;
|
import com.fengdu.gas.repository.po.DataUploadRecordMonthPO;
|
import org.apache.ibatis.annotations.Select;
|
|
import java.util.List;
|
|
/**
|
* 数据上报记录-月统计 mapper
|
* @author zr
|
*/
|
public interface DataUploadRecordMonthMapper extends BasicMapper<DataUploadRecordMonthPO> {
|
|
@Select("SELECT point_name,facility_name,columns_code,min_value,max_value,avg_value,TO_CHAR(TO_TIMESTAMP(upload_date, 'YYYY-MM-DD HH24:MI:SS'), 'MM') AS upload_date\n" +
|
" FROM data_upload_record_month \n" +
|
" WHERE point_id=#{pointId} and columns_code=#{columnsCode} AND upload_time BETWEEN #{beginTime} AND #{LastTime}")
|
List<DataUploadRecordMonthPO> getLineChart(Long pointId, String columnsCode, Long beginTime, Long LastTime);
|
}
|